Repentant Boko Haram Member Allegedly Kills Borno Businessman Over N1,000
A repentant Boko Haram member working with Civilian Joint Task Force (CJTF) personnel has allegedly killed a businessman in Mafa Local Government Area of Borno State over a sum of just N1,000.
The victim, identified as Alhaji Jidda Muhammad, was reportedly shot while traveling from Gomboru Ngala to Maiduguri. A friend of the deceased, Asharif Dan Borno, confirmed the incident in a Facebook post on Sunday, October 5, 2025.
According to Dan Borno, Muhammad was confronted by the suspect, who demanded N1,000. When he refused, he was shot with an AK-47. “This wasn’t just a robbery. It was a cold-blooded execution,” he wrote, describing the killing as a stark example of the ongoing insecurity in the region.
Dan Borno questioned how former insurgents could operate freely despite their history of violence. “How did we get here? How can known terrorists operate unchecked? Why is leadership silent while our people are slaughtered?” he wrote, emphasizing the broader failure of protection and justice in Borno State.
